The other thing that can fail is the shaft hole in the Rotor can get rounded out and allow the shaft to spin without turning the Rotor. The Rotor might look ok with the cover off, it might even spin, but when the cover is on and a load put on it, the Rotor may slip. Pull the Rotor and examin the hole for wear.
